#799647 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#799647 is composed of 47.5% red, 58.8%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 82 degrees, a saturation of 35.7% and a lightness of 43.3%. #799647 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2ff8e with #002d00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#799647 color description : Dark moderate green.
#799647 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#799647 has RGB values of R:121, G:150,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 7968327.

Shades and Tints of #799647
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030402 is the darkest color, while #f8faf5 is the lightest one.
